We are looking for a talented and experienced Sr. Mobile/Web Full Stack Typescript Developer with proven experience ReactJS, React Native and AWS services.The candidate will be responsible for designing visually appealing Apps and websites with focus on business platforms.Job responsibilities:Develop efficient front-end and back-end solutions using TypeScriptDesign and implement TypeScript-based user interfaces and application logicIntegrate APIs and services into TypeScript applicationsCollaborate with designers and developers to create and enhance applicationsConduct TypeScript code reviews, ensuring code quality, organization, and automationRun unit and integration tests for TypeScript applicationsParticipate in agile development processes related to TypeScriptFront-end required experience:5 years working with ReactJS with NextJSProficient understanding of state management framework - ReduxProficient in using front-end testing: Jest, React Testing LibraryProficient in responsive web developmentBack-end required experience:- 5 years of experience with Node.Js, AWS API Gateway and Lambda using Typescript- Experience with DynamoDB is idealOther requirements:Adhering to CLEAN and SOLID principles is a mustProficiency in object-oriented programming (OOP) conceptsUnderstanding of software design patterns and best practicesAbility to write clean, maintainable, and well-documented codeExperience with version control systems such as GitExcellent problem-solving skills and ability to work in a fast-paced environmentStrong communication skills and ability to collaborate effectively with cross-functional teamsAbout UsAIDONIC AG, headquartered in Zug, Switzerland, is dedicated to revolutionizing the humanitarian aid, development, and philanthropy sectors.
We empower NGOs, UN agencies, and governments with innovative digital tools that streamline fundraising, enhance aid delivery, and provide indisputable transparency to donors and impact investors.
By leveraging blockchain, AI, and digital payment solutions, we ensure swift, secure, and effective aid distribution to those who need it most.
Our mission is to create a transparent, efficient, and impactful ecosystem, envisioning a world where humanitarian and philanthropic efforts are more accountable and responsive to the evolving needs of communities affected by disasters, conflicts, and poverty.If you're passionate about designing and building intuitive digital experiences, we'd love to hear from you!